Most people don't think about technology... until it doesn't work.Sam is one of the unlucky few who thinks about it all the time. For years, he’s been a leader in a corporate IT department, buried under the weight of broken processes, endless escalations, and the quiet resignation of a team that feels more like a punishment than a calling. He's tired, burned out, and knows there has to be a better way to work. But he can't see a path to it.Then, a new CTO arrives. A visionary who talks not about technology, but about people. Not about user experience, but about human experience.Suddenly, a dormant project on Digital User Experience (DEX) is back on the table, and Sam is tasked with proving its value. What starts as a small pilot in a single hospital soon becomes a quiet revolution. He must win over skeptics, navigate turf wars, and prove that his team can do more than just fix problems. They can prevent them.Everyone Noticed is a compelling novel about how one leader finds his purpose by transforming broken systems. It’s a story about the unseen problems that frustrate us every day and the power of a single idea to change a company forever. This book is for anyone who has felt the slow burn of corporate burnout, and a reminder that sometimes, the greatest work we do is the kind no one ever sees... until it's too late not to. Read more
